Analysis and Research on Winter Temperature Change Trend of Main Stations in Hunan Province from 1951 to 2020
In order to study the trend of winter temperature increase or decrease in Hunan Province in the past 70 years,the data of 20 main temperature monitoring stations such as Sangzhi,Shimen and Nanxian were selected.Lin-ear Regression Modeling was used to analyze the three indicators of average temperature,average maximum tem-perature,and average minimum temperature at these stations.The results show that in the past 70 years,the average winter temperature,average minimum temperature and average maximum temperature in Hunan Province have shown an overall upward trend,but there are differences in the temperature rise or fall of different stations,and the average temperature rise is higher than the average minimum temperature and average maximum temperature.The temperature rise in Changsha area is the highest compared to other station areas,while the average maximum tem-perature in Chenzhou and Yongzhou in December shows a slight downward trend.Sangzhi is the station with the smallest temperature rise among all stations.
